For explanation purposes, I will use $150,000 as the 1065 line 22 amount. We have three partners. When I check the individual K1-199A Supplement forms, each form has the amount $50,000 listed as QBI code Z. The activity is listed as "1065 Line 22." This appears correct, as the 1065 line 22 amount should be divided by 3 in order to equally allocate to each partner. Because this is the only QBI for the Company, the "Total" for QBI code Z is also $50,000 for each partner. These numbers are correctly indicated on the K1-199A Supplement forms. So far, so good...
The problem is with the 199A Summary Worksheet. The only entry on this form is in the "Total Amounts by Activity" table. In the first line of this table, under the "Activity" column is listed "1065 Line 22". The amount listed under column "QBI code Z" is $150,000. This is the only entry, so the Total for the "QBI code Z" is also $150,000. This information appears to be correct. It also is the total of the amounts on each of the K1 - 199A Supplements. Again, so far so good.
When I run the error check to verify that the return is ready to file, one error occurs. The error is with the 199A Summary Worksheet. The error message indicates: "Form 1065 p4-5 - 199A Sum Wks: Activity total: QBI tot exceeds the sum of totals from all copies of the Schedule K-1 - 199A Supplement by 2. Adjust Schedule K-1 amounts as necessary"
However, the amount of $150,000 shown under QBI Total is exactly the sum of the three individual K-1 Supplements which are $50,000 each. Is this a bug in Turbo Tax, or am I missing something? Turbo Tax will not allow me to e-file while this error is present.
